About the Camp

Overview

Camp Knutson was founded in 1953 when former Minnesota Congressman, Harold Knutson, donated his summer vacation property to be used as a summer retreat for children with special needs.

We partner with other organizations to host camps for youth and adults with identified needs such as autism, heart disease, skin conditions, down syndrome, burn survivors, HIV/AIDS and youth experiencing homelessness. Campers are enrolled through our partner groups, who work in collaboration with our staff to provide specialized care and curriculum for their campers' needs. Camp Knutson is open year round hosting retreats, meetings, trainings, and other social gatherings September through May.

Camp Knutson is a service of the Lutheran Social Service of Minnesota (LSS). Camp Knutson serves all individuals regardless of religion, race, ethnicity, and diversity.

Our Camp Partners

Our partner organizations handle camper registration, individual camper support, and medical support during camp. Programming is provided in collaboration with Camp Knutson staff to offer activities that best meet the needs of each camper. Activities might include archery, horseback riding, boating and swimming, arts and crafts, outdoor games and much more. Camp Knutson provides a medically-sound environment, fully accessible facilities, supportive programming and an inclusive, welcoming community.

Camp Discovery (American Academy of Dermatology)

Dates Camp #1 - July 1 - 6 Camp #2 - July 8 - 13
Camp Discovery offers children living with a chronic skin condition a one-of-a-kind camp experience. Provided at no cost to the families, Camp Discovery is one week of fun for kids with conditions ranging from eczema and psoriasis, to vitiligo and alopecia, to epidermolysis bullosa and ichthyosis.

Camp Hand in Hand (Autism Society of MN)

Dates Camp #1 -June 19 - 23 Camp #2 - June 25 - 29 Camp #3 - August 5 - 9 - August 11-15

AuSM-trained camp counselors and experienced program staff carefully plan and maintain a well-run, relaxed, and rewarding camp experience. All four sessions of Camp Hand in Hand are held at Camp Knutson. Campers are all paired 1:1 with a staff member and participate in activities that focus on social interaction and communication.

LSS of Minnesota Youth Services & TheShop Brainerd

Dates TBD for 2024
LSS youth services from the Twin Cities, Brainerd, and Duluth along with local youth serving non-profit TheShop, team up with Camp Knutson to put on a precious, well deserved camp experience for youth experiencing homelessness. This opportunity allows the youth to put their worries to rest while they are at Camp and htlps them build coping skills and resiliency.
